Who is in the Wolfpack Clone Wars?

Commander Wolffe
The Wolfpack was a clone trooper squad in the 104th Battalion of the Grand Army of the Republic. They served under Jedi General Plo Koon and Clone Commander Wolffe during the Clone Wars between the Galactic Republic and the Confederacy of Independent Systems. Members included Boost, Sinker, and Comet.

What episodes does Gregor appear in?

Gregor first appeared in “Missing in Action,” an episode of the fifth season of the Star Wars: The Clone Wars television series. A preview clip featuring Gregor was later shown at Celebration VI. He is voiced by Dee Bradley Baker.

Who is Wolffe and Gregor?

Wolffe was a decorated and respected Commander of the Clone Army and was the leader of the infamous Wolfpack Squad. Gregor, on the other hand, was a commando who was presumed dead after the Battle of Sarrish. In truth, he crash landed on Abafar and was suffering from amnesia.

Who is captain Gregor bad batch?

Gregor was a clone commando during The Clone Wars who suffered amnesia after crash-landing on the planet Abafar. With no memory of who he was or his greater purpose in the galaxy, he worked as a dishwasher not knowing there were millions of men across the universe who shared his face.
